📢 AJIC Spotlight
CRE bacteremia remains a major threat.
🦠 This study shows:
• Higher 30-day & 1-year mortality vs non-CRE
• Worse outcomes in CP-CRE
• Targeted therapy improves survival

📢 AJIC Update
VAE may be relatively uncommon—but the impact is significant.
🫁 This study finds:
• VAE in 5.6% of ventilated patients
• Longer ventilation & hospital stays
• Worse overall outcomes

📢 AJIC Spotlight
Are we overlooking a key infection risk?
🚨 CRPA outbreak in a transplant ward linked to:
• Drainage catheter contamination
• Protocol lapses
• Clonal transmission (WGS confirmed)

📢 AJIC Update
Can a multimodal approach reduce CAUTI?
📉 This study shows:
• Strong multidisciplinary collaboration
• Improved catheter care compliance
• Major drop in infection rates (SIR ↓ to 0.168)

📢 Hospital curtains can harbor pathogens—but what if we rethink them?
🦠 This study shows antimicrobial disposable curtains:
• Lower bacterial contamination
• Stay below safety thresholds
• Cut costs by ~60%
